Written directives for drinking water lead testing — Based on results received from the certified water samplers, the facility exceeded 5.5 ppb of lead in their water source. Once received, the facility took immediate and proper actions to make the drinking fountain inaccessible by placing tape over it and placing a do not drink sign. This poses a potential health, safety, or personal rights risk to persons in care.
Written directives for drinking water lead testing — Based on interview and record review, the licensee did not comply with the section cited above in one out of one objects, the facility has not tested for lead as stated on the written directives which poses a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.
Mandated reporter training — Based on interview and record review, the licensee did not comply with the section cited above in one out of one persons, once staff member did not have a current Mandated Reporter Training which poses a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.
Personal Rights — Based on observation and interview, the facility did not comply with the section cited above as LPA at 12:20PM observed S1 remove C1 during scheduled nap time, the video footage was for an incident that occured Febuary 7, 2025 which poses a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.

California pre-grades every violation itself: Type A means an immediate risk to a child's health, safety, or personal rights; Type B means a violation that, if not corrected, could become that same immediate risk. We never escalate above the state's own grade.
🔴 Serious concerns — any of:
- The license is on probation — CCLD requires the facility to comply with specific terms and conditions to prevent revocation of its license
- A Type A violation is on record — CCLD's own most serious grade, meaning an immediate risk to a child's health, safety, or personal rights
🟡 Watch carefully — any of:
- A Type B violation is on record — CCLD's own lesser-risk grade, meaning a violation that, if not corrected, could become an immediate risk to a child's health, safety, or personal rights
🟢 Clean
Actively licensed, with no violations in your lookback window.
Worth knowing: California's public records don't always say whether a specific violation was later fixed, so we don't discount a Type A's severity by guessing at correction status — CCLD's own definition notes a Type A citation "will always be issued, even if the violation is corrected on the spot." A single Type A moves a facility to Serious concerns, matching CCLD's own grading directly.
